Caye Caulker/San Ignacio: Travel by boat and bus from Caye Caulker to San Ignacio. Enjoy an included pottery demonstration and local lunch at a G Adventures-supported women's pottery cooperative.
San Ignacio: Opt to visit the sacred Mayan cave Actun Tunichil Muknal or check out the seldom-visited Mayan ruins of Xunantunich.
San Ignacio/Flores: Learn about Mayan culture and history on a guided tour of the ruins of Tikal.
Flores/Rio Dulce: Travel across the country towards the coast to Rio Dulce, on the shores of Lake Izabal.
Rio Dulce/Antigua Guatemala: Enjoy an orientation walk of Antigua's cobblestone streets, then opt to take a salsa lesson and practice new moves out at night.
Antigua Guatemala: Enjoy a free day in Antigua. Opt to relax with a massage, climb a volcano, soak up the culture in one of the city's many caf?s, or explore the nearby hills and towns by bike.
Antigua Guatemala/Panajachel: Travel to beautiful Lake Atitl?n and enjoy the views.
Panajachel/San Juan La Laguna: Embark on a boat ride across the lake before participating in a G Adventures-supported homestay with a local family. This area is known for stunning scenery and great shopping for Mayan handicrafts. Opt to bargain for colourful textiles and paintings at the lake's markets.
San Juan La Laguna/Antigua Guatemala: Return to Antigua, and enjoy a Big Night Out with the group.
